Michelle Obama: A Quick Biography
Michelle Obama was born Michelle LaVaughn Robinson on January 17, 1964, in Chicago, Illinois. She grew up on the city's South Side in a working-class family. Her father worked at a water filtration plant, and her mother was a stay-at-home mom who later became a secretary. Michelle went to Princeton University and then Harvard Law School, where she met Barack Obama.
After a successful career in law and public service, Michelle became the First Lady of the United States in 2009 when Barack Obama was elected president. During her time in the White House, she focused on issues like healthy eating, military families, and education. After leaving the White House in 2017, she continued her advocacy work and published her bestselling memoir, Becoming.
Personal Details & Bio Data
Category | Details |
---|---|
Name | Michelle LaVaughn Robinson Obama |
Date of Birth | January 17, 1964 |
Place of Birth | Chicago, Illinois, U.S. |
Spouse | Barack Obama |
Children | Malia Ann Obama, Sasha Obama |
Education | Princeton University (B.A.), Harvard Law School (J.D.) |
Occupation | Author, lawyer, former First Lady |
